    Abstract: A method of manufacturing a semiconductor device is disclosed. In the method, a substrate having a first surface and a second surface is provided. The second surface is opposed to the first surface. A via hole is formed to penetrate the substrate from the first surface toward the second surface. The via hole includes a first portion and a second portion. The first portion has a first sidewall which is substantially perpendicular to the first surface. The second portion has a second sidewall which gradually decreases from the first surface toward the second surface, and has a bottom surface that substantially flat. A seed pattern is formed on the first sidewall of the first portion, the second sidewall of the second portion and the bottom surface of the second portion of the via hole. A first thickness (Vt) of the seed pattern on the first sidewall of the first portion is less than a second thickness (VIt) of the seed pattern on the second sidewall of the second portion.

    Abstract: The need for backup diesel generators in a data center is obviated by using fuel cells to convert a fuel to electrical energy, which provide backup power to equipment in a data center, which may include the servers in the data center and other important systems that normally use utility power. When the utility power fails, the equipment switches to backup power that is provided by fuel cells supplied with fuel (such as natural gas), possibly using a source of temporary power (e.g., a UPS or direct tie-in of batteries) while the fuel cells come online. The fuel may also be used to power a turbine or generator, coupled to a chiller for providing a cooled liquid to a cooling system.
